    LEAVING META
    WITHOUT LEAVING YOUR LIFE 💎

    After my posting about Meta over the past two days, one thing became very clear.

    A lot of people would LIKE to leave Facebook, Instagram, or both. But parts of their actual lives are all tangled up in them.

    So don’t make leaving a purity test. Start somewhere. Remove Facebook from your phone and use it only on your laptop, or better still, only on your desktop when you genuinely need it.

    STOP POSTING TO META. STOP FEEDING THE TIMELINE.

    Move conversations with real friends to your email, text, Signal, phone calls, Mastodon account, or wherever works for you, away from Meta.

    TELL PEOPLE WHERE ELSE THEY CAN EASILY FIND YOU.

    If you run a business, start putting your email address and/or website URL everywhere you promote your business so Facebook is not your only front door.

    Download anything you actually want to keep. Then, when you’re ready, deactivate or delete what you no longer need.

    Maybe you keep Messenger for Aunt Doris. Maybe you keep Instagram because your local café apparently believes websites were abolished in 2014.

    Fine.

    The point isn’t ideological cleanliness.

    THE POINT IS REDUCING YOUR DEPENDENCE.

    Every conversation you move elsewhere is one conversation Meta no longer owns the doorway to.

    YOU DON'T HAVE TO ESCAPE THE META CAGE IN ONE HEROIC LEAP.

    Just start opening the door.
